To the Board: As I hand responsibilities to Marta Evelund, please note the pending budget request for the Kellerbrook warehouse expansion. The request totals 1.4 million and has been reviewed twice by Finance; depreciation schedules and contingency margins are documented in the appendix. Marta will present the revised figures at the November sitting. I ask the Board to treat the timing sensitively, as approval affects our supplier negotiations. The strategic context is summarised in the confidential note below.

management briefing: Silethax Systems plans to raise the Holix list price by 50.2 percent in December. The steering committee signed off on a budget of $329.9 million for Project Holok. The renewal with Juldorax Foods closes at $278.2 million a year, 54.3 percent above the last contract. Project Briir slips by one quarter because of the supplier delay.

Visitor policy — temporary site: During the Hollis Wing renovation, all visitors report to the cabin at Greer Yard. Escort required beyond the fence line at all times. Hi-vis mandatory. No photography near the crane pad. Facilities desk issues day passes only. For the cabin's secure store, use the access code below.

door code, yagap-bahof: bdg-O-05

MANAGEMENT MEETING MINUTES — Project Kestrel

Attendees: Operations, Finance, Delivery leads.

Project Kestrel now eight weeks behind schedule. Root cause: vendor tooling delays plus internal resourcing gaps. Finance flagged budget overrun risk by Q2. Recovery plan drafted; approval pending incoming director. Next review in two weeks. For context, the confidential note on business plans appears directly below.

board note of fahog-bawep: The renewal with Holixax Holdings closes at $20 million a year, 20 percent below the last contract. Project Druwyn slips by two quarters because of the supplier delay.